It was a different era when, as a teenager, Arnaud Marius was sinking three-pointers in the sports hall of Pluguffan, near Quimper (Finistère). In 2014, at just 27 years old, when he took the helm of BCM Gravelines-Dunkerque, a leading team in French basketball, he became, according to him, one of the youngest general managers in the history of the National Basketball League
